According to Milwaukee Bucks superstar Giannis Antetokounmpo, he does not emulate his game to any player. He is his own player who’s blazed his own path in the league — one that, among other things, has led to an NBA championship.
This doesn’t mean, however, that Giannis does not admire the greats that have come before him. In fact, by his own admission, there is one current-day player whom Antetokounmpo very much looks up to. That man is LeBron James.

In a recent sit-down with Bally Sports Wisconsin, Giannis was asked all sorts of questions that aimed to shed more light on the type of player and person that he is. When asked if he could compare his game to any player past or present, Antetokounmpo responded by saying that he doesn’t emulate his game after anyone.
Giannis, however, gave a list of all-time greats who he considers to be his idols. One of them was Los Angeles Lakers talisman LeBron James:
“People that I look up to, it’s for sure Hakeem (Olajuwon), Magic (Johnson), [Kevin Garnett], Kobe (Bryant), LeBron, obviously. Everybody grew up a LeBron fan,” Giannis said.

Giannis has had his fair share of battles with LeBron James on the court through the years, and there’s going to be more to come in the near future.
There’s no denying that these are two of the top players in the game today and it’s also a fact that both will go down in history as two of the greatest to ever pick up a basketball. It’s just nice to hear Giannis giving LeBron his flowers in such a reverent manner.
